Position Overview

Performs various tasks relating to the safe and efficient transport of passengers on a tram vehicle for District 6 Bob Harrison Senior Center. This is a part-time weekday position. Must be able to adhere to a flexible schedule. Must be available for early morning and afternoon trips.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

(All duties listed may not be included in any one position nor does the list include all tasks found in a position of this class.)

  • Operates a tram vehicle safely and efficiently in accordance with established routes, schedules, and operating procedures.
  • Assists passengers with boarding and exiting the tram, including passengers with disabilities or special needs, if required.
  • Monitors track conditions, traffic crossings, weather conditions, and other operational hazards and notifies dispatch of potential problems.
  • Reports accidents, incidents, delays, or other safety concerns to dispatch and appropriate personnel.
  • Reports malfunctioning equipment, vehicle defects, or damage to the tram.
  • Conducts pre-trip and post-trip inspections of the tram, including brakes, lights, doors, mirrors, communication systems, safety equipment, and other operating components prior to placing the vehicle into service.
  • Responsible for ensuring the tram interior and operators compartment are maintained in a clean and orderly condition and that the vehicle is prepared for service on an ongoing basis.
  • Maintains accurate operational records, logs, and reports as required.
  • Adheres to all safety regulations, operating procedures, and customer service standards.

Education and Experience

Education and Experience

  • Must be a high school graduate or equivalent.
  • Experience operating passenger transit vehicles, rail vehicles, or other commercial transportation equipment preferred.

Other Requirements

Knowledge, Skill, and Ability

  • Excellent customer service skills.
  • Ability to interact with a diverse group of people.
  • Knowledge of requirements and standards related to the safe and efficient operation of passenger transit vehicles.
  • Skill in the operation of rail vehicles or commercial transportation equipment.
  • Knowledge of federal, state, and local regulations governing the operation of passenger transit systems.
  • Ability to identify vehicle problems, equipment malfunctions, and safety hazards and report them appropriately.
  • Knowledge of basic first aid and/or CPR techniques.
  • Ability to maintain records and complete required reports accurately.
  • Excellent situational awareness and attention to detail.
  • Ability to remain calm and exercise sound judgment in emergency situations.

Physical Requirements

  • Must have the mobility to safely operate a tram vehicle.
  • Must be able to sit for extended periods and occasionally walk, stand, bend, and climb steps.
  • Lift up to 50 lbs.

Certifications or Licenses Required

  • Must be at least 21 years of age and possess a valid Alabama Drivers License.
  • Must possess or be able to obtain any licenses, certifications, or operator permits required to operate a tram/light rail vehicle.
  • A satisfactory driving record that demonstrates a commitment to safety with no more than two moving violations and no accidents within the previous three years and no suspensions, disqualifications, or revocations.
  • Minimum of two years of verifiable experience operating commercial vehicles, rail vehicles, or completion of a qualified, comprehensive operator training program preferred.
  • Must maintain a good driving record with the Alabama Department of Public Safety.
  • Must successfully complete a drug screen, physical examination, and any required operator training and certification programs.
  • Must have no prior history of drug/alcohol abuse or addiction.
  • Must not have been convicted of a felony, crime of moral turpitude, or an offense involving alcohol or other drugs.

Schedule

Primarily Monday through Friday, along with weekend and holiday flexibility when needed; up to 29 hours per week.
